Course Details

Sponsorship Proposal Development: Learning the process of creating effective sponsorship proposals, including researching potential sponsors, identifying their goals and values, and tailoring proposals to meet their needs.
Sponsorship Activation: Understanding how to bring sponsorships to life through creative and impactful activations, both on-site and off-site, that engage audiences and deliver on sponsor objectives.
Event Budgeting and Financials: Gaining expertise in event budgeting, including forecasting revenues and expenses, tracking actuals, and managing cash flow, to ensure the financial success of sponsored events.
Contract Negotiation and Management: Acquiring skills in negotiating and managing sponsorship contracts, including legal considerations, payment terms, and performance metrics.
Sponsorship Sales and Revenue Generation: Learning strategies for selling sponsorships, including prospecting, pitching, and closing deals, as well as maximizing revenue through upselling and cross-selling opportunities.
ROI and Evaluation: Understanding how to measure the success of sponsored events through key performance indicators (KPIs), return on investment (ROI) calculations, and post-event evaluations.
Ethics and Compliance: Developing an understanding of the ethical considerations and legal requirements involved in sponsorship event management, including anti-bribery and corruption regulations, intellectual property rights, and data protection.
Digital and Social Media Strategies: Exploring the role of digital and social media in sponsorship event management, including content creation, distribution, and engagement tactics that drive reach and impact.

Career Path

In the UK market, various roles within Sponsorship Event Management are in demand, offering competitive salary ranges and opportunities for growth. The 3D Pie chart above highlights the percentage share of demand for different roles in this field. 1. **Sponsorship Coordinator**: A Sponsorship Coordinator typically manages relationships with sponsors, coordinates logistics, and ensures effective communication. With 45% of the demand, this role is vital for successful event management. 2. **Event Manager**: Event Managers oversee all aspects of event planning, organization, and execution. They contribute 25% to the demand in this industry, with responsibilities ranging from vendor management to audience engagement. 3. **Sponsorship Consultant**: Sponsorship Consultants focus on sourcing and securing sponsorships, helping businesses and organizations maximize their return on investment. This role accounts for 18% of the demand in the UK market. 4. **Marketing Specialist**: Marketing Specialists develop and execute marketing strategies for events, creating brand awareness and driving ticket sales. They contribute 12% to the demand for professionals in Sponsorship Event Management. As a growing field, Sponsorship Event Management requires professionals with a strong understanding of marketing, communication, and organizational skills.
